10个必学PHP函数,让你的开发速度飞升!
PHP 是一种流行的编程语言,用于 Web 开发,许多开发者都使用它。PHP 有许多函数和方法,可以帮助开发者更快、更高效地开发 Web 应用程序和网站。在本文中,我们将分享 10 个必学 PHP 函数,让你的开发速度飞升!
1. strlen()
在 PHP 中,strlen() 函数用于获取字符串的长度。它返回一个整数,表示字符串中字符的数量。例如,如果你想计算 "Hello World" 这个字符串的长度,可以使用以下代码:
$str = "Hello World"; $len = strlen($str); echo $len; // 输出 11
2. strpos()
strpos() 函数用于在字符串中查找另一个字符串的位置。它返回 个匹配字符的位置,如果没有找到匹配字符,则返回 false。例如,如果你想查找 "Hello World" 字符串中的 "World" 子字符串的位置,可以使用以下代码:
$str = "Hello World"; $pos = strpos($str, "World"); echo $pos; // 输出 6
3. str_replace()
str_replace() 函数用于替换字符串中的部分内容。它接受三个参数: 需要被替换的字符串、需要替换的字符串以及替换的新字符串。例如,如果你想把字符串中的 "World" 替换为 "PHP",可以使用以下代码:
$str = "Hello World";
$newStr = str_replace("World", "PHP", $str);
echo $newStr; // 输出 Hello PHP
4. explode()
explode() 函数用于将字符串分割为数组。它接受两个参数:分割字符串的标记以及需要被分割的字符串。例如,如果你想将一个由逗号分隔的字符串分割成数组,可以使用以下代码:
$str = "PHP,JavaScript,Python";
$arr = explode(",", $str);
print_r($arr);
// 输出 Array ( [0] => PHP [1] => JavaScript [2] => Python )
5. implode()
implode() 函数用于将数组转换为一个字符串。它接受两个参数:连接数组元素的字符串以及需要被连接的数组。例如,如果你想将一个数组转换为逗号分隔的字符串,可以使用以下代码:
$arr = array("PHP", "JavaScript", "Python");
$str = implode(",", $arr);
echo $str; // 输出 PHP,JavaScript,Python
6. file_get_contents()
file_get_contents() 函数用于读取一个文件的内容。它接受一个参数,表示需要读取的文件。例如,如果你想读取一个名为 "example.txt" 的文件,可以使用以下代码:
$content = file_get_contents("example.txt");
echo $content;
7. file_put_contents()
file_put_contents() 函数用于将内容写入一个文件。它接受两个参数, 个参数表示要写入的文件,第二个参数表示要写入的内容。例如,如果你想将一段文本写入名为 "example.txt" 的文件,可以使用以下代码:
$content = "Hello World";
file_put_contents("example.txt", $content);
8. isset()
isset() 函数用于检查变量是否已经设置并且不为 null。如果变量已经设置并且不为 null,isset() 函数返回 true,否则返回 false。例如,如果你想检查变量 $name 是否已经设置过,可以使用以下代码:
if (isset($name)) {
echo "变量已经被设置过";
} else {
echo "变量没有被设置过";
}
9. empty()
empty() 函数用于检查变量是否为空。如果一个变量为 0、空字符串、null 或者空数组,empty() 函数返回 true,否则返回 false。例如,如果你想检查变量 $name 是否为空,可以使用以下代码:
if (empty($name)) {
echo "变量为空";
} else {
echo "变量不为空";
}
10. var_dump()
var_dump() 函数用于输出变量的详细信息,包括类型和内容。例如,如果你想查看变量 $arr 的详细信息,可以使用以下代码:
$arr = array("PHP", "JavaScript", "Python");
var_dump($arr);
以上就是 10 个必学 PHP 函数,它们是 PHP 编程中最常用的函数。学习并掌握这些函数,将为你的开发工作带来很大的帮助,提高你的开发速度和效率。
